Does Kinkuna or Calavos have better schools?

On average school ICSEA (the ACARA index that benchmarks educational advantage), Kinkuna scores 951 vs 945 in Calavos. ICSEA is a school-community indicator, not a quality rating, so always check NAPLAN results and catchment boundaries for the specific address you're considering.
